🔹 1. Understand What the Card Is
The RBC ION Visa is a no annual fee credit card issued by the Royal Bank of Canada (RBC). It allows you to earn Avion points on everyday purchases such as groceries, gas, streaming services, public transit, rideshare apps, and more.
📋 Eligibility Requirements
Before starting the application, make sure you meet the following requirements:
- Residency: You must be a resident of Canada.
- Age: You must have reached the age of majority in your province or territory (usually 18 or 19).
- Credit profile: RBC will assess your creditworthiness. While the bank does not state a minimum credit score, having a good credit history (around 660 or higher) improves your chances of approval.

🧠 Step‑by‑Step Application Process
1️⃣ Choose Your Application Method
There are three main ways to apply:
• Online
Go to the RBC credit cards page, find the RBC ION Visa, and click “Apply Now” to complete the secure online form.
• In‑Branch
You can also visit an RBC branch and apply with the help of a representative – useful if you want guidance or assistance gathering documents.
• By Phone
Call RBC’s credit card application line (e.g., 1‑800‑769‑2512 in Canada) and ask a representative to guide you through the application.
2️⃣ Complete the Application Form
Whether online or with a representative, you will need to provide:
- Full name and date of birth.
- Contact information.
- Residential address and residency status.
- Employment and income details.
Tip: Make sure all information is accurate and matches your official documents to avoid delays.
3️⃣ Review the Card Terms
Before submitting, RBC will ask you to read and accept the card’s terms and conditions, including fees, interest rates, and rewards details. Reading carefully prevents surprises later.
4️⃣ Submit Your Application
Click “Submit” online, hand the form to a branch representative, or finalize the details by phone. Many applications receive a decision within minutes, though RBC may take a few business days if additional documents are needed.
5️⃣ Receive the Decision
- If approved, your physical card will be mailed to your address in approximately 7–10 business days.
- If more information is required, RBC may request additional documents (such as proof of income or ID).
